Which describes conservation of resources

1 answer

Conservation of resources refers to the sustainable and efficient use of natural resources, such as water, energy, land, and materials, to ensure their availability for future generations. It involves reducing waste, minimizing consumption, recycling materials, and using renewable resources whenever possible to preserve the environment and prevent resource depletion. Conservation of resources is essential for maintaining ecological balance, promoting economic growth, and supporting human well-being.
